Baltimore Mayor wants park named for Robert E. Lee changed, other monuments may come down
The Atlanta Journal-Constitution ^ | June 25, 2015

Posted on 06/25/2015 6:13:31 AM PDT by Oldeconomybuyer

First the flag, now monuments honoring the Confederacy may be coming down.

Baltimore Mayor Stephanie Rawlings-Blake is pushing for the name of a park in the city to be changed. The park is named after Robert E. Lee and it is the latest push to erase history related to the Confederacy in the wake of the deadly church shooting in Charleston, South Carolina last week.

A member of the Baltimore chapter of the Sons of the Confederate Veterans said the hatred of the flag is an attempt to hide history.

Elliot Cummings told WBAL, "We are becoming like the Taliban. They are going after monuments, they are going after parks, they are going after anything that has the Confederate name associated with it. The battle flag is the flag of our soldiers; the flag of our great-great-grandfathers."

Maryland was a slave state. They were allowed to keep their slaves, an expedient to keep them in the union. The Emancipation Proclamation didn’t apply to them, just to states under rebellion. Maryland’s slaves weren’t officially freed until the 13th Amendment was ratified.
